Default Brakes

Under normal driving conditions (i.e. very little hard braking or racing), how
many miles should the brakes last? I bought my Coupe new, and it now has
about 23,000 miles on it (daily driver) after about 14.5 months of ownership.
Thanks.

Default Re: Brakes (jmX)

65k miles on stock front brakes! With cracked rotors?!?!?!? Remind me not to go for a ride in your car.

Brakes are kinda important....if you value your head, I'd consider replacing them with a little more frequency -- even if they "appear" not to need it.

Hopefully those of you going 65k miles are doing so with regular brake inspections. Regular check ups of the functioning of the calipers, condition of the brake lines, rotors, etc. seems like common sense to me.

You spent $30-$50k for the car, spend $250 to replace your brakes at regular intervals.

A cracked rotor is only one panic stop away from an accident.
